Role Summary
As the Maintenance Manager, you will be responsible for the agenda within the Operations and Test areas. You will be accountable for the maintenance and asset effectiveness of the manufacturing areas, through the development of the team, processes, ways of working and the consistent application of improvement to these areas.
In this role you'll own the delivery of a sustainable maintenance programme; being an exceptional coach, team player, catalyst for change and developing the operational teams to achieve optimum productivity, whilst reaching strategic goals. Development of best practices within the value stream teams and wider operations, whilst offering cross-site join-up with FM and outsourced contractors alongside delivering site commitments will be a significant part of this role.
Core Responsibilities
- Leading and developing the engineering excellence programme in line with best practice methodology and principles
- Delivering positive results through adoption of the effective utilisation of Programme Maintenance (PM), Lean and best practice operational approaches
- Supporting the Operations Test Leads and Module Managers in developing the capability of individuals, teams and processes as the site transitions through it's phases of growth, adoption and implementation of New Ways of Working
- Developing a Best Practice Maintenance Framework which delivers improvement in 3 over-arching metrics (People, Process and Plant)
- Driving a Reliability Centred Maintenance (RCM) culture through establishment of planned maintenance, predictive maintenance and pro-active techniques
- Monitoring and reviewing PM information and KPI's to drive continuous improvement of global efficiency
- Developing capital and expenditure (CAPEX) strategies to support essential replacement to best utilise financial resources
- Leading daily update meetings
- Ensuring compliance with any regulations for the control of technical data
